Story Time ✨🐾 Meet Bourbon
Bourbon arrived at the Pup Sitter ranch with quiet strength, his soulful eyes carrying stories of both struggle and resilience. He had lost his front right leg to bone cancer, and the battle had left him weary. The chemotherapy took its toll, and though his spirit remained unbroken, his body needed time to catch up.
From the moment he stepped onto the ranch, something unspoken passed between him and I. I, too, had fought my own battle against cancer and emerged stronger. Our meeting felt destined...two souls who understood each other’s pain, both seeking solace and renewal.
Each Reiki session became a sacred moment. As my hands hovered over Bourbon, warmth and light seemed to flow between them. His breathing would slow, his body relaxing as the nausea and fatigue ebbed away. And with every session, something shifted, not just in Bourbon, but in me, too. I felt lighter, stronger, as if his healing mirrored my own.
Over time, Bourbon grew steadier on three legs, finding his balance in a way that was nothing short of inspiring. He no longer mourned what he had lost but embraced what remained. He ran, he played, and with every visit, he showed me that survival was not just about enduring...it was about thriving.
One day, as Bourbon rested in the sun, I knelt beside him, running my fingers through his fur. “You taught me something,” I whispered. “That we don’t need everything we once thought we did. We are whole, even in our loss.”
Bourbon lifted his head, nudging my hand with his nose. He understood.
As the seasons changed, so did they. Bourbon left the ranch healthier, his spirit soaring, while his I stood a little taller, my heart fuller. We had healed together, bound forever by a lesson in resilience, love, and the undeniable power of second chances.
